ANES ferry company launches route from northern Evia to Skiathos, Skopelos

A new ferry route has been launched by ANES ferry company linking northern Evia to the islands of Skiathos and Skopelos in the Sporades cluster, marking the inauguration of a port in Kymasi, on the northeastern coast of the island.

The new line is expected to significantly boost arrivals to the popular islands from residents of Evia and the eastern coast of mainland Greece, who had to travel to Piraeus to catch a connection. It will also facilitate travel from the northern and eastern parts of Attica, via Halkida, which has a bridge connection between Evia and the mainland.
